N,N'-Di-Boc-thiourea, identified by CAS number 145013-05-4, is one such critical intermediate, particularly recognized for its utility in the research of α1-adrenoceptor antagonists.

Alpha-1 (α1) adrenoceptors are a class of G protein-coupled receptors found throughout the body, including in smooth muscle tissue and the central nervous system. Antagonists targeting these receptors have found significant therapeutic applications, most notably in the treatment of hypertension (high blood pressure) and benign prostatic hyperplasia (BPH). The development of selective and effective α1-adrenoceptor antagonists often relies on sophisticated synthetic routes, where precisely designed building blocks are essential.

N,N'-Di-Boc-thiourea serves as a key precursor in the synthesis of bis-imidazoline diphenyl derivatives. These derivatives are a well-established structural class of α1-adrenoceptor antagonists. The presence of the two tert-butoxycarbonyl (Boc) protecting groups on the thiourea nitrogen atoms is crucial. These groups allow for controlled chemical transformations, guiding the synthesis towards the desired bis-imidazoline ring structure while preventing unwanted side reactions.
